HS Football: Lexington Wins 4th Straight Behind 3 TDs from Markale Martin

placeholder image

The Lexington Minutemen won their 4th game in a row on Friday, as the beat OCC rival Mansfield Senior, 48-6, on homecoming in Lexington.

The Minutemen led 14-0 after the 1st quarter on TD passes by QB Joe Caudill to Brayden Fogle and Seven Allen. Lex increased the lead to 41-0 at halftime behind 2 TD runs from Markale Martin ( 7 yard and 22 yard runs), a 24 yard pick 6 on defense by Fogle and Cohen Boozer recovered a fumble in the endzone.

Martin found the end zone for the 3rd time in the 3rd quarter to give Lex their 1st win at home over Mansfield Senior since 2011.

The victory for the Minutemen is their 4th in a row, where they have piled up a combined 191 points. Lex, now 5-1 and 2-0 in the OCC, has a huge league game on Friday at West Holmes (5-1, 3-0).

Mansfield Senior got a 36 yard TD pass in the 4th quarter from QB Sean Tanner to DJ Corbin. The TYgers are 0-6 for just the 4th time in school history and the first time since 1997.
